Sowing and Planting Equipment Market Outlook 2026–2034: Precision Planting Adoption, Farm Mechanization Growth, Leading Companies, and Future Opportunities

The Sowing and Planting Equipment Market Size is valued at $ 14.17 billion in 2026. Worldwide sales of Sowing and Planting Equipment Market are expected to grow at a significant CAGR of 5.85%, reaching $ 23.7 billion by the end of the forecast period in 2034.

Sowing and Planting Equipment Market infographic showing growth from USD 14.17 billion in 2026 to USD 23.7 billion by 2034 at a CAGR of 5.85%.

Sowing and planting equipment includes seed drills, planters, air seeders, broadcast seeders, transplanters, precision planting systems, and related attachments used for cereals, grains, oilseeds, pulses, cotton, vegetables, forage crops, and specialty crops. Market growth is supported by farm mechanization, labor shortage, higher food production needs, seed cost optimization, precision agriculture adoption, and demand for faster and more accurate crop establishment.

1. What is the latest trend in the Sowing and Planting Equipment Market?

The latest trend is the adoption of precision planting systems with GPS guidance, variable-rate seeding, section control, seed monitoring, and automated row-unit adjustment.
Farmers are using smarter equipment to improve seed placement accuracy, reduce seed waste, and improve field productivity.
Manufacturers are also adding sensors, telematics, cloud connectivity, and AI-enabled navigation to planters and seed drills.
John Deere has introduced new planter technologies such as seed-level sensing, fertilizer-level sensing, and active vacuum automation for model-year planters.

2. What are the key challenges in the Sowing and Planting Equipment Market?

Key challenges include high equipment cost, limited affordability for small farmers, seasonal demand, maintenance complexity, and uneven mechanization levels across regions.
Precision planters and advanced seed drills require skilled operation, software familiarity, reliable service networks, and compatible tractors.
Farmers also face financing constraints, fragmented landholdings, soil variability, and uncertainty linked to weather and crop prices.
In developing markets, adoption can be slower where custom hiring, dealer support, and after-sales service remain limited.

3. What is the major driving factor for the Sowing and Planting Equipment Market?

The major driving factor is the need to improve planting efficiency, crop yield, seed utilization, and farm productivity.
Growing food demand, labor scarcity, rising wages, and large-scale farming are encouraging farmers to adopt mechanized seeding and planting systems.
Precision planting helps maintain correct seed depth, row spacing, seed-to-soil contact, and plant population.
Demand is further supported by government farm mechanization programs, replacement demand, and digital agriculture adoption.

4. What is the major segment in the Sowing and Planting Equipment Market and why?

Seed drills and planters represent major product categories because they are widely used across cereals, grains, oilseeds, pulses, corn, cotton, and row crops.
Seed drills are important for continuous row sowing, while planters are preferred where accurate seed spacing and singulation are required.
Row crop planters are gaining strong attention as farmers adopt precision planting for corn, soybean, cotton, and other high-value crops.
Air seeders are also expanding in large-field operations because they support high-capacity seeding with improved operational efficiency.

5. Which application or end-user is driving more demand?

Large farms, commercial growers, contract farming operators, custom hiring centers, and agricultural service providers are driving more demand.
Cereal and grain producers use seed drills and air seeders for wheat, rice, barley, and other broad-acre crops.
Row crop growers use precision planters for corn, soybean, cotton, sunflower, and oilseed crops.
Vegetable and horticulture growers are increasing demand for transplanters and specialized planting equipment to reduce labor dependency.

6. Which region offers the highest growth potential and why?

Asia Pacific offers the highest growth potential due to large cultivated area, rising mechanization, government support, and labor shortages in major farming economies.
China, India, Japan, South Korea, Vietnam, Indonesia, and Australia are important markets for seed drills, planters, rice transplanters, and precision planting systems.
Research and market coverage identifies Asia Pacific as the fastest-growing planting equipment region, supported by mechanization subsidies, large rice and wheat cultivation areas, and shrinking rural labor availability.
North America and Europe remain important mature markets due to advanced precision agriculture adoption and large-scale mechanized farming.

9. Why is sowing and planting equipment strategically important?

Sowing and planting equipment is strategically important because crop establishment directly influences yield, input efficiency, and farm profitability.
Accurate seed depth, row spacing, plant population, and fertilizer placement help improve uniform emergence and reduce crop losses.
Mechanized planting reduces labor dependency and allows farmers to complete operations within short weather windows.
For equipment manufacturers, planting machinery is a key entry point into precision agriculture, digital services, and lifecycle aftermarket revenue.
